La Voz is Hector's debut solo album after his split with Willie Colon and features many members from Willie's original band. His versatility as a vocalist and sonero is on display as he goes from boleros to Salsa with ease.
This influential release set the salsa world on fire! Known as one of the most popular salsa albums in the history of Latin music, Siembra includes the Blades masterpiece "Pedro Navaja," and classic hits "Buscando Guayaba" and "Pl stico."
